Selecting the Right Tequila
Not all tequilas are good for cooking. Your soup needs a spirit that matches the tomato base without taking over the taste.
- Blanco (Silver) Tequila: Crisp and clean, perfect for bright flavor profiles
- Reposado Tequila: Offers subtle oak undertones that enhance depth
- Avoid añejo tequilas, which can overpower the soup’s delicate balance

The Importance of High-Quality Lime
Your lime choice is crucial. Fresh, juicy limes add the acid and brightness that make this soup unique.
- Choose limes that are heavy for their size
- Look for smooth, bright green skin
- Roll the lime before juicing to maximize juice extraction
Pro tip: Zest your lime before juicing to capture maximum citrus essence in your soup!

Tips for Storing and Reheating Tequila-Lime Tomato Soup
Keeping your tequila-infused soup fresh is key. It’s all about how you store and reheat it. Your lime-kissed soup needs special care to stay tasty and smooth. Here’s how to keep it delicious from start to finish.
Proper Storage Techniques
Storing your soup right is important. Here are some tips:
- Cool the soup completely before storing
- Use airtight containers made of glass or BPA-free plastic
- Refrigerate within two hours of cooking
- Store in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days
Best Practices for Reheating
Reheat your lime-kissed soup carefully. Follow these steps:
- Transfer soup to a medium saucepan
- Heat on medium-low temperature
- Stir occasionally to prevent scorching
- Add a splash of broth if the soup seems too thick
Freezing and Thawing Guidelines
Storage Method | Duration | Recommended Process |
---|---|---|
Freezer Storage | Up to 3 months | Use freezer-safe containers |
Thawing Process | 6-8 hours | Refrigerator thawing recommended |
Reheating Frozen Soup | 10-15 minutes | Slow, gentle heating on stovetop |
Pro tip: Leave some space at the top of your container when freezing to allow for expansion, preventing potential cracks or breaks.
